Original caption: " The Reverend Sydney Smith in comfortable middle age. A celebrated wit and intellectual and one of the founders of the Edinburgh Review, Smith was hardly a typical clergyman, yet many of the challenges he faced in making his way in the world were common to young men entering the Church; and, like many clergymen, he battle isolation and depression in his rural living. " |
